Kenyans on Twitter have questioned June Ruto’s ambassadorial role to Poland. June is the daughter of Deputy President William Ruto.

Foreign Affairs CS Monica Juma posted photos with June as she received her in Warsaw where she is on a diplomatic trip.

Arrived in Warsaw, Poland, this morning to attend the Warsaw Summit which will be looking at security in the Middle East, taking place tomorrow. Was received by June Ruto, Charge D’Affaires,” read the tweet.

The tweet brought back similar questions that arose in 2014 when June joined the Ministry of Foreign Affairs – with rumours flying around that she was Kenya’s envoy to Poland

Both the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and Ruto’s office denied the rumour.

Image result for Ruto with June

A ministry official earlier stated that June is in the country as an International Relations and Trade officer under the America directorate at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s.

She currently serves as one of the senior-most ranks in Foreign Service. As a Charge D’Affaires, she heads an embassy in the absence of an ambassador.

Kenya does not have an official embassy in Poland.

June holds a master’s degree in International Studies from the University of Queensland, Australia and a bachelor degree in Diplomacy from the United States International University in Nairobi.
